Capture a frozen moment and turn it into a tonally unique sonic foundation.

The Electro-Harmonix Freeze Sound Retainer pedal delivers infinite sustain of any note or chord at the press of a momentary footswitch. Release the footswitch and again you are sample-ready. The Freeze Sound Retainer pedals' 3 selectable decay rates—including a latch mode—guarantee liquid smooth tonal transitions. Hook the E-H Freeze Sound Retainer to your favorite pedals for a sonic collage unlike anything you've ever heard. The Freeze Sound Retainer is almost like Electro-Harmonix adding an extra musician to your band.

Features

  • Real-time sample capture with perfect looping
  • Latch mode for infinite sustain at the touch of a momentary switch
  • Fast decay mode
  • Slow decay mode
  • Latch mode for infinite sustain of sample capture
  • Smooth tonal transitions between captures
  • Optional 9.6DC 200 power supply

Play a chord and step on the foot switch immediately after, and the chord will be sustained until you let up. As you can imagine, this has somewhat limited applications -- if you want to sample and repeat more complex phrases instead of just one chord/note, you should invest in a loop sampler instead. That said, the Freeze does exactly what it claims, and there's no other pedal that provides this functionality.

As an aside, the timbre of this pedal is glassy and ghost-like. I find it pleasing.

Think of the Freeze as an improvement on the "drone string" paradigm. No more, no less.

The pedal works as advertised. However, pedal placement will dictate the quality of the sound and the effect you get.I found the pedal to be thin sounding at the end of the chain probably due to the analog-to-digial-to-analog process. However, If you place it at the beginning of the chain with distortion or overdrive following that, you will sound like your holding a power chord forever. Quite cool. And, with the latch mode on, you could set your guitar down, go get a bite to eat, and it would still be playing! Not sure how useful that would be!!Great pedal. Endless possibilities.
